Khalifa University is seeking a highly motivated Post-doctoral Researcher to join an innovative research project focused on deriving and improving risk prediction approaches for cardiovascular disease (CVD). The successful candidate will play a central role in the development and evaluation of quantitative models that leverage clinical and longitudinal health information to support improved estimation of CVD risk.

The project will involve the collection and extraction of large-scale health data from centralized electronic health records and management and harmonization of existing research cohorts to construct an analytical dataset suitable for research purposes. The postdoctoral researcher will coordinate and support data collection and preparation activities and collaborate with key stakeholders to ensure appropriate data quality and management throughout the project lifecycle.

The role includes applying advanced analytical and computational methods to model disease risk over time and contributing to the translation of research outputs into tools with potential clinical relevance. The researcher will also participate in disseminating findings through scientific publications and collaborative activities.

This position offers an excellent opportunity to work with rich clinical datasets, engage in applied methodological research, and contribute to translational work with relevance to public health and clinical practice.

PhD in Biostatistics, Statistics, Epidemiology, Data Science, Public Health or related field.

  • Strong background in quantitative research and data-driven analysis.
  • Experience working with health-related, population, or large-scale research datasets.
  • Familiarity with computational or statistical tools used in applied research settings.
  • Good experience in R and/or Python for statistical analysis and modeling.
  • Demonstrated research experience in clinical, public health, epidemiological or related contexts.
  • Good analytical judgement and problem-solving ability.
  • Capacity to work independently while managing multiple research tasks.
  • Willingness to contribute positively to a collaborative research team.
  • Good English language communication skills (verbal and written).
  • Ability to work effectively in an organized, deadline-driven research environment.
  • Track record of research experience in in clinical, public health, epidemiological or related contexts.
  • Experience with electronic health records (EHR) or other large clinical datasets.
  • Experience in time-to-event analysis, mixed effect models and deep learning methods.
  • Experience in supporting data preparation, quality assurance, and analytical activities within a research project
